Hawaiian Fruit Salad

10 oz. miniature marshmallows

8 oz. coconut

10 oz. maraschino cherries

32 oz. cottage cheese

16 oz. sliced peaches

16 oz. fruit cocktail

20 oz. pineapple chunks

16 oz. mandarin oranges

10 oz. whipped topping

Drain fruit. Put all ingredients together in a large bowl. Mix well and cover. Refrigerate until serving time.

I made a couple of changes: I cut the marachino cherries in half and didn't use as many. I used the small curd cottage. This is a good summer fruit recipe. Enjoy it at a family picnic or a barbeque.
